《Python数据库连接库database_connector-1.0.0详解》 在Python开发中,与数据库交互是不可或缺的一部分,尤其在处理大量数据时。database_connector-1.0.0-py2.py3-none-any.whl是一个Python库,专为简化数据库连接而设计。此库兼容Python 2和Python 3,意味着无论你正在使用哪个版本的Python,都能无缝集成到你的项目中。 让我们了解什么是.whl文件。.whl是Python的二进制分发格式,类似于Java的.jar或.NET的.exe。它包含预编译的Python模块,使得用户无需安装其他依赖就能快速安装和使用库,极大地简化了安装过程。database_connector-1.0.0-py2.py3-none-any.whl的命名规则遵循PEP 427,其中“none”表示这个包不依赖特定的本地化环境,“any”则表示它适用于所有CPU架构。 database_connector库的核心功能在于提供了一个简洁、高效的接口,允许开发者轻松地连接到各种数据库。这可能包括常见的关系型数据库如MySQL、PostgreSQL、SQLite,以及非关系型数据库如MongoDB等。通过统一的API,开发者可以减少学习多个数据库驱动的时间,提高代码的可读性和可维护性。 该库通常会包含以下关键组件: 1. **连接管理**:提供创建、管理和关闭数据库连接的功能,确保资源的有效利用,防止内存泄漏。 2. **查询构建器**:帮助构建SQL查询语句,支持复杂的查询操作,如JOIN、WHERE条件、GROUP BY、ORDER BY等。 3. **事务处理**:支持原子性操作,确保数据的一致性和完整性。 4. **结果集处理**:返回查询结果,并提供迭代、转换和过滤数据的方法。 5. **错误处理**:封装了数据库错误,提供一致的错误处理机制,方便开发者调试和处理异常情况。 6. **适配器系统**:为了支持多种数据库,library通常包含一个适配器系统,允许根据目标数据库自动选择合适的驱动程序。 在实际应用中,使用database_connector库可以大大提升开发效率,让开发者更专注于业务逻辑,而不是底层数据库操作。例如,你可以这样初始化一个连接: ```python from database_connector import Database db = Database('mysql', 'localhost', 'username', 'password', 'database_name') ``` 然后执行查询: ```python result = db.query("SELECT * FROM table_name WHERE condition") for row in result: print(row) ``` database_connector-1.0.0是一个强大的Python数据库连接库,它提供了跨平台、多数据库的支持,简化了数据库操作,是Python开发者处理数据库任务的理想工具。如果你的项目需要与数据库进行交互,那么这个库无疑值得你考虑和使用。
- 1
- 粉丝: 14w+
- 资源: 15万+
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助